I found something out which helped me so I thought I share it. If you suffer from high stress and ruminate /overthink a lot: write your thoughts down no matter how crazy you think they are. Don't come up with a system, don't try to make it 'good' or 'perfect'. Just you, your thoughts and a physical pen and paper. For me, it feels like the circulating thoughts are 'done' and they are out of my brain. It sounds so obvious! Maybe that's why I didn't do this earlier. #mentalhealth #actuallyautisic

⚠️ CW – Suicide Prevention Month (TBI and Suicide)⚠️
September is National suicide prevention month and many members of the Invisible Disability Community are at high risk but, they're not alone. Individuals in the LGBTQIA community are "four times more likely" to make such an attempt for much the same reason as disabled individuals. The way they are mistreated and stigmatized in society. It is also the second leading cause of death for young people in the US between the ages of 18 and 25. "Native American communities experience higher rates of suicide compared to all other racial and ethnic groups in the US being the eighth leading cause of death…".
I thought this would be a good time to migrate and repost a piece I did on TBI "traumatic brain injury" and suicide to include these other at risk groups. What can you do if someone in your life is at risk? Spend some time with them, don't be judgmental, listen and love. If you see them being victimized or bullied, stand up and say something.
TBI - Traumatic Brain Injury and Suicide (originally posted Dec 27, 2022)
Why support is so important for those that live with TBI and Brain Injury. Between 2014 to 2017, the traumatic brain injury-linked death rate rose from 16.3 to 17.5 per 100,000 people.
There were 61,131 TBI-linked deaths in 2017 alone, and nearly half of these deaths were by suicide or homicide from 2015 to 2017. Last summer, a rash of suicides on the USS Washington raised questions about lack of support and services said to contribute to these deaths.The links below present the dismal statistics and some ways to help prevent suicide among the population living with Brain Injuries and other marginalized people.

CW: Addressing ableism
I know at least one person who needs to hear this: being autistic and/or ADHD isn't a "mental health condition". It's a neurotype. Nothing is wrong with us. We are normal, we are fine, we are just as awesome as people of other neurotypes.
Its a mental health condition only in so much as being a woman, trans, queer, ect are mental health conditions. That is to say, the bigotry against us causes mental health problems. The systems that aren't designed to include us make the world harder to exist in.
And please never tell us that we're being toxic and off-putting, or that you hope we get [mental] help when we mention being autistic and/or ADHD and talk about facing ableism for it. It's no different than telling any other marginalized group the same stuff.
